Understanding PIR Roof Panels
PIR Roof Panels 160 mm Insulation consists of rigid foam boards made from polyisocyanurate, a material renowned for its high thermal resistance. This insulation type is favored in both commercial and residential buildings due to its performance capabilities. The panels are lightweight yet provide superior insulation, which translates to lower energy costs and enhanced comfort indoors.
Moreover, these panels are available in various sizes and thicknesses, with the 160 mm variant being particularly popular for its balance of space-saving and thermal efficiency. The thicker the insulation, the better the thermal performance, making PIR Roof Panels an excellent choice for energy-conscious builders and homeowners.
Benefits of Using PIR Roof Panels 160 mm Insulation
One of the most compelling benefits of PIR Roof Panels 160 mm Insulation is their ability to significantly reduce heat loss. Studies have shown that effective insulation can decrease heating and cooling costs by up to 30%. This is especially crucial in climate zones that experience extreme temperatures, where maintaining a consistent indoor climate can pose challenges.
Additionally, PIR panels are manufactured with excellent moisture resistance, reducing the risks of mold and structural damage over time. This feature makes them particularly beneficial in areas that are prone to high humidity or rainfall. By choosing PIR Roof Panels 160 mm Insulation, property owners can invest in a product that not only guards against energy loss but also enhances the durability of their structures.

Cost-Effectiveness Over Time
While the initial investment in PIR Roof Panels 160 mm Insulation might be higher than traditional insulation methods, the long-term savings frequently outweigh upfront costs. Homeowners and businesses benefit from reduced energy bills, along with potential tax incentives for using energy-efficient products. Additionally, the longevity of PIR panels means fewer replacements over time, maximizing overall cost-effectiveness.
